Assessing Your Current Cryptocurrency Holdings

Begin your migration to a post-quantum wallet by conducting a comprehensive inventory of all your cryptocurrency holdings across different wallets, exchanges, and platforms. Document the types of wallets you're currently using and determine which rely on classical cryptographic methods vulnerable to quantum attacks.

Evaluate the security level of your current wallets, noting which use traditional elliptic curve cryptography (ECC) and which may already incorporate some post-quantum features. This assessment helps prioritize which assets to migrate first based on their value and security needs.

Remember that Ethereum verifies ECDSA signatures on-chain, meaning no wallet can make on-chain signatures quantum-safe by itself. The migration process focuses on protecting your private keys and backup materials using quantum-resistant methods. Selecting the Right Post-Quantum Wallet Solution

Research and compare different post-quantum wallet options, considering factors like algorithm implementation, security features, user interface, and compatibility with your existing cryptocurrency holdings. Look for wallets that implement NIST-standardized algorithms like ML-KEM-768 (Kyber) and ML-DSA-65 (Dilithium).

Consider hybrid wallets that combine classical and post-quantum cryptographic methods as a transitional solution. These wallets provide immediate quantum resistance while maintaining compatibility with existing blockchain networks.

Preparing for the Migration Process

Before initiating the migration, ensure you have secure backups of your current wallet recovery information. Double-check that you can successfully recover your current wallets before transferring any funds.

Set up your new post-quantum wallet according to the manufacturer's security recommendations. This typically involves generating new cryptographic keys using post-quantum algorithms and securely backing up the new recovery information.

Start with a small test transfer to verify that you can successfully send funds to your new post-quantum wallet and that the receiving wallet functions correctly. This minimizes risk during the learning phase.

Executing the Migration Safely

Transfer your cryptocurrency holdings from your current classical wallets to your new post-quantum wallets in phases, starting with smaller amounts and gradually increasing as you become confident in the process.

Verify each transaction carefully, ensuring that funds arrive correctly in your post-quantum wallet and that you can access them using the new wallet's recovery methods. Check transaction details on blockchain explorers to confirm successful transfers.

Maintain detailed records of your migration activities, including transaction IDs, timestamps, and the status of each transfer. This documentation helps troubleshoot any issues that may arise during the process.

Post-Migration Security Verification

After completing the migration, verify that you can access all your cryptocurrency holdings in your new post-quantum wallets. Test sending and receiving transactions to ensure full functionality.

Securely dispose of any sensitive information related to your old classical wallets, ensuring that recovery phrases and private keys are completely destroyed after confirming successful migration.

Update your cryptocurrency management practices to align with post-quantum security principles, including backup strategies, key rotation schedules, and monitoring procedures for your new wallets.

FAQ

Why should I migrate to a post-quantum wallet?

Post-quantum wallets use cryptographic algorithms that are believed to be resistant to attacks from both classical and quantum computers. As quantum computing technology advances, migrating to quantum-resistant solutions protects your assets from future threats.

Is it safe to migrate cryptocurrency to a post-quantum wallet?

Yes, if you follow proper security procedures. Always verify that you can access your new wallet before transferring significant amounts, and maintain secure backups of both old and new recovery information during the transition.

Will my cryptocurrency lose value during migration?

No, cryptocurrency value is not affected by wallet migration. The migration process simply moves your existing coins from one wallet to another without impacting their market value or blockchain properties.

How long does the migration process take?

The migration timeline varies based on the number of wallets, total value being transferred, and blockchain network congestion. Plan for the process to take several hours to days, especially for large portfolios.
